Justification
Marsilea aegyptiaca is widespread and not in danger of extinction. It is therefore assessed as Least Concern.
Distribution
Endemism
Not endemic to South Africa
Provincial distribution
Free State, Gauteng, Limpopo, Northern Cape, North West, Western Cape
Range
This species is widespread across South Africa. It also occurs in northern, southern and tropical Africa.
Habitat and Ecology
Major system
Freshwater
Major habitats
Nama Karoo, Savanna
Description
Plants grow in temporary pools in arid areas, ± 1200 m.
